Arithmetic Essentials: Building Blocks for Math

Mathematics is a complex field, and its foundations are built upon the essential principles of arithmetic. Basic arithmetic operations like add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division form the building blocks for all further mathematical concepts. Mastering these core skills equips individuals with the ability to approach a wide range of problems in everyday life and progress in more specialized areas of mathematics.

From calculating sums at the grocery store to executing complex scientific computations, arithmetic holds a vital role. By understanding and applying these fundamental concepts, students can develop a strong base for future mathematical learning.

Exploring Key Topics in Arithmetic

Arithmetic is the foundation of all mathematical knowledge, providing us with the tools to quantify the world around us. When investigating into key topics in arithmetic, we discover fundamental concepts such as add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division. These calculations are the building blocks for more sophisticated mathematical concepts. A strong understanding of these basic arithmetic abilities is essential for success in various fields, including science, engineering, and finance.

Beyond the fundamental operations, arithmetic also encompasses topics like fractions, decimals, percentages, and ratios. These notions allow us to communicate quantitative information in a more accurate manner. Through application, we can develop a expertise in arithmetic that allows us to solve real-world challenges.
